Transaction d160af8fc3a2510115fa8c0034e7bbba3a7e77ee98f58bfb4ef19b474a9af8ae
1 Input
1 Output
-
d160af8fc3a2510115fa8c0034e7bbba3a7e77ee98f58bfb4ef19b474a9af8ae:0
- value
- 63543013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5537cf4b4ac791f559d98534567c94799b84e3a5 OP_EQUAL
- address
- 39TcDaVSkoLnFczGxh8ocSnNQbX15Dt29R